Compartilhar via


Mensagem PBM_SETRANGE

Define os valores mínimo e máximo para uma barra de progresso e redesenha a barra para refletir o novo intervalo.

Parâmetros

wParam

Deve ser zero.

lParam

O LOWORD especifica o valor mínimo do intervalo e o HIWORD especifica o valor máximo do intervalo. O valor mínimo do intervalo não deve ser negativo. Por padrão, o valor mínimo é zero. O valor máximo do intervalo deve ser maior que o valor mínimo do intervalo. Por padrão, o valor máximo do intervalo é 100.

Valor retornado

Retorna os valores de intervalo anteriores, se bem-sucedido ou zero, caso contrário. O LOWORD especifica o valor mínimo anterior e o HIWORD especifica o valor máximo anterior.

Comentários

Se você não definir os valores de intervalo, o sistema definirá o valor mínimo como 0 e o valor máximo como 100. Como essa mensagem expressa o intervalo como um inteiro sem sinal de 16 bits, ela pode se estender de 0 a 65.535. O valor mínimo no intervalo pode ser de 0 a 65.535. Da mesma forma, o valor máximo pode ser de 0 a 65.535.

Para definir um intervalo maior, chame PBM_SETRANGE32.

Requisitos

Requisito Valor
Cliente mínimo com suporte
Windows Vista [somente aplicativos da área de trabalho]
Servidor mínimo com suporte
Windows Server 2003 [somente aplicativos da área de trabalho]
Cabeçalho
Commctrl.h

Confira também

Referência

PBM_GETRANGE

PBM_SETRANGE32